Microfilariae Onchocerca alcis Bain et Rehbinder, 1986 – a new parasite of moose Alces alces (L.) in Poland

Aleksander W Demiaszkiewicz1, Katarzyna J Filip1.   

Abstract

Onchocerca alcis Bain et Rehbinder, 1986 belongs to the subfamily Onchocercinae. Mature nematodes of O. alcis are located on the surface of hindlimb tendons. The aim of this article was to describe the occurrence of microfilariae of O. alcis in the skin of moose from Kampinos Forest. This is the first report of O. alcis in moose from Poland and the third finding of this rare species in the world.
